The Chinese Football Association (CFA) announced on Saturday it would form its own professional referee team, which would include both domestic and overseas distinguished football referees.
At the briefing, CFA confirmed that the professional referee team will be built by a combination of domestic elite referees and signed overseas professional referees. Chinese referees Ma Ning, Fu Ming, Zhang Lei and two foreign referees Mark Clattenburg and Milorad Mazic will become the first professional referees to CFA.
The former Premier League ref Mark Clattenburg has finished a two-year stint as director of refereeing in Saudi Arabia and will be one of five professional referees in the Chinese top flight from next month.
"Introducing the professional referee system will promote the comprehensive development of Chinese football referees, the levels and standards of referees will be improved to ensure all football leagues in China play a fair and impartial game," said Chen Yongliang, the director of Chinese Super League Department.

Chen also said, in the coming season of CFA Super League, special funds will be set up to encourage all teams to play with more net match time. The Super League will set the 60 minutes net match time goal for the teams.
Any team which achieves the goal will be awarded a "60 minutes net match time" trophy and 100,000 yuan (15,000 U.S. dollars). The League will also set the "season net match time biggest improvement award" and the "highest season net match time award", both requiring at least 55 minutes. Winners of the awards will be granted one million and two million yuan (150,000 U.S. dollars and 300,000 U.S. dollars) respectively.
Chen said the CFA Super League will publish the top 80 domestic players ranked by their comprehensive abilities in every round of the Super League Game, adding that "it will help Chinese national football team pick players with more scientific basis."
